WebExplore Michigan Bumble Bees. MNFI manages a statewide long-term data set of bumble bee occurrences across Michigan. The data shown here include historic and current observations from museum, academic, personal, and citizen science sources. Over 12,000 bumble bee records are included in the interactive map. WebMay 26, 2024 · Throw out partial bags of pet food. Store in a hard plastic container with a tight lid. Check behind stoves and other appliances, which may harbor treats and secret passages for larder beetles. Clean this area and seal any gaps. Seal any gaps in doors and windows that could allow entry to larder beetles or other pests.
